For freelancers, managing finances can be a daunting task. Between chasing payments, tracking expenses, and calculating taxes, it’s easy to feel overwhelmed. Fortunately, there’s a simple and effective tool many freelancers leverage: a free invoice tracker Excel sheet.

The Power of an Invoice Tracker

An invoice tracker Excel sheet is essentially a digital ledger designed to help you organize and monitor all your invoices. Instead of relying on scattered documents and mental notes, you can centralize all your invoice information in one easily accessible place. This offers numerous benefits:

  • Organization: Keeps all invoice details in a structured format, making it easy to find specific invoices.
  • Tracking: Helps monitor the status of each invoice (sent, viewed, paid, overdue).
  • Financial Overview: Provides a quick snapshot of your income, outstanding payments, and overall financial health.
  • Time Savings: Automates calculations and reduces the time spent on manual bookkeeping.
  • Professionalism: Projects an image of professionalism and efficiency to clients.

Key Features of a Free Invoice Tracker Excel Sheet

While specific templates may vary, most effective free invoice tracker Excel sheets include the following essential features:

  • Invoice Number: A unique identifier for each invoice, crucial for tracking and referencing.
  • Date Issued: The date the invoice was sent to the client.
  • Client Name: The name of the client or company being billed.
  • Client Contact Information: Email address and phone number for easy communication.
  • Description of Services/Products: A clear and detailed description of the work performed or products provided.
  • Quantity/Hours: The quantity of products or the number of hours worked.
  • Rate/Price Per Unit: The hourly rate or the price per unit of product.
  • Subtotal: The total cost of services/products before taxes or discounts.
  • Tax Rate and Amount: The applicable tax rate and the calculated tax amount.
  • Discount (if applicable): Any discounts applied to the invoice.
  • Total Amount Due: The final amount the client owes, including taxes and discounts.
  • Payment Due Date: The date by which the payment is expected.
  • Payment Status: A field to track whether the invoice is sent, viewed, overdue, paid, or partially paid.
  • Payment Method: The method the client used to pay (e.g., PayPal, bank transfer, check).
  • Notes: A section for any additional notes or comments related to the invoice.

How to Use a Free Invoice Tracker Excel Sheet Effectively

Downloading a free invoice tracker Excel sheet is the first step. However, to maximize its benefits, follow these best practices:

  1. Customize the Template: Most free templates are generic. Take the time to customize the sheet with your logo, branding colors, and preferred font to create a professional look.
  2. Set Up Automatic Calculations: Ensure that the sheet is configured to automatically calculate subtotals, taxes, discounts, and the total amount due. This reduces errors and saves time.
  3. Establish a Consistent Naming Convention: Develop a clear and consistent naming convention for your invoice files (e.g., “Invoice_ClientName_Date.xlsx”). This makes it easier to locate specific invoices quickly.
  4. Regularly Update the Tracker: Make it a habit to update the tracker every time you send an invoice, receive a payment, or have any communication related to an invoice.
  5. Use Data Validation for Drop-Down Menus: Implement data validation for fields like “Payment Status” and “Payment Method” to create drop-down menus. This ensures consistency and reduces data entry errors.
  6. Utilize Conditional Formatting: Use conditional formatting to highlight overdue invoices or invoices that are approaching their due date. This helps you prioritize your follow-up efforts.
  7. Back Up Your Data: Regularly back up your invoice tracker to a secure location, such as a cloud storage service or an external hard drive. This prevents data loss in case of computer malfunctions.
  8. Generate Reports: Use the data in your tracker to generate reports on your income, outstanding payments, and client payment patterns. This information can be valuable for financial planning and forecasting.
  9. Integrate with Other Tools (Optional): Consider integrating your invoice tracker with other tools you use, such as accounting software or CRM systems. This can streamline your workflow and reduce manual data entry.
  10. Regularly Review and Refine: Periodically review your invoice tracking process and identify areas for improvement. As your business evolves, your needs may change, and you may need to adjust your tracker accordingly.

Finding Free Invoice Tracker Excel Sheet Templates

Numerous websites offer free invoice tracker Excel sheet templates. Here are a few reputable sources:

  • Microsoft Office Templates: Microsoft offers a variety of free invoice templates directly within Excel.
  • HubSpot: HubSpot provides a free invoice template that’s easy to download and customize.
  • Smartsheet: Smartsheet offers a collection of free Excel invoice templates, including those specifically designed for freelancers.
  • Vertex42: Vertex42 provides a wide range of free Excel templates, including several invoice tracker options.
  • Zoho Invoice: While Zoho is primarily a paid invoicing software, they offer a free invoice template for download.

When choosing a template, consider your specific needs and the features that are most important to you. Don’t hesitate to try out a few different templates before settling on the one that works best for your workflow.

Beyond Excel: When to Consider Invoicing Software

While a free invoice tracker Excel sheet is a great starting point for many freelancers, there are situations where dedicated invoicing software may be a better option. Consider upgrading to invoicing software if:

  • You have a high volume of invoices: Managing a large number of invoices in Excel can become cumbersome.
  • You need advanced features: Invoicing software often offers features like automated payment reminders, recurring invoices, and integration with payment gateways.
  • You want enhanced security: Invoicing software typically provides better security for your financial data than a simple Excel file.
  • You need collaboration features: If you work with a team, invoicing software can facilitate collaboration and streamline the invoicing process.

Popular invoicing software options include Zoho Invoice, FreshBooks, QuickBooks Self-Employed, and Wave Accounting.
